Discovery Park of America Offering Free Admission
The Discovery Park of America is partnering with Magnolia Place Assisted Living and offering free admission for January 2024 to children 17 years of age and younger as the museum and heritage park kicks off the celebration of its eleventh birthday.

The Mid-South Ice House is offering a Homeschool Learn to Skate Program every Wednesday, from 9 a.m. to 9:30 a.m. All ages from three to adult are welcome to attend. After the class, students are invited to stay free for the weekly Homeschool Skate from 9:30 a.m. to 11:30 a.m.

Mandatory Tennessee Promise Team Meetings for Homeschool Students {West Tennessee}

All Tennessee Promise applicants are required to attend a team meeting to remain eligible for the scholarship. Students should attend the team meeting that is held in the county where they live. READ MORE
